Unless the rules have changed, how does a General Motors automatic transmission bolt up to a Toyota (or BMW) engine, and even more curious, how does a Japanese car get around that pesky rule that has always required the transmission (and rearend) being used, to be of the same manufacturer as the car? Or did Toyota buy GM while nobody was looking? I really doubt that this so called "Production" Toyota car is available at the Toyota dealership with a GM Turbo 400 transmission connecting the engine to the , I assume, Toyota rear axle assembly.
just throw the rule books away to let some BS combo compete, this is why people are leaving stock for bracket racing etc,

Interesting car. Little bit shorter wheelbase at 97.2", but not much rear overhang. Probably be listed in the guide at 3,250 lbs shipping weight and maybe rated at 350 hp which would make it a natural "C" car for stock.

Just my guesses.

It's possible NHRA is just soliciting participation from the largest auto manufacturer in the world (by a large margin) in order to gain sponsorship and participation. And while I understand the 'purist' view point having a Toyota stocker is more reasonable than having a "Camry" bodied funny car or stamping TOYOTA on a Hemi (or Camry in NASCAR). Toyota's leadership was smart enough to recognize that EV's aren't the perfect solution other manufacturers seemed to buy into so I'd say let them play on our playground and see how it unfolds.
